“This athanor is designated for works according to the dry path , where the three alchemical principles are forced into separation through a process of calcination, fusion, sublimation, conjunction, and dry distillation of the prepared matter.” … “In the dry path, the subtle principles are transferred from medium to medium through fusion, and it is therefore considered to be much shorter and more dangerous, not to mention warmer, than the wet path. The wet path produces a separation of the three principles through fermentation and exaltation, where a menstruum extracts the subtle principles. It is considered to be longer and safer than the dry path.”
